Optimal control of coherent anti-Stokes Raman scattering image contrast
in: Applied Physics Letters (2012)
Optimal control of CARS image contrast is reported. The setup combines an evolutionary strategy and a closed-loop feedback with a liquid-crystal spatial modulator to control the spectrum of the Stokes pulse within a CARS scheme to optimize the vibrational contrast of CARS images. The CARS excitation spectrum is optimized for image contrast at a pre-determined wavenumber position. The optimization feedback uses an image-contrast parameter generated from the image itself as the experimentally imposed fitness parameter. This strategy allows for enhancing the image contrast by a factor of up to 2.6.
